Course content
On the MA Applied Linguistics and TESOL (campus-based), you will broaden and deepen your understanding of core areas of linguistics and its application to language learning and teaching. You will gain in-depth knowledge about language structure and language use, and learn how to analyse language using qualitative and quantitative research methods. The course also supports you in developing a critical awareness of approaches and issues in relation to the teaching and learning of English.
Through your choice of option modules and dissertation topic you can customise your degree towards your professional interests. You will be taught by our academic team who are highly experienced EFL teachers as well as internationally recognised experts in their research fields.

English Language Requirements
IELTS 6.5 or equivalent, with at least 6.0 in each component score. If your first language is not English, you may need to provide evidence of your English language ability. If you do not yet meet our requirements, our English Language Teaching Unit (ELTU) offers a range of courses to help you to improve your English to the necessary standard.
